Summary
Slurry filter operators manage and operate filtration equipment to adjust the moisture content of slurry used in the ceramics and porcelain manufacturing process.
Description
Slurry filter operators manage and operate filtration devices (such as vacuum filters and belt filters) that separate water from the suspension of ceramic raw materials called slurry. They handle a wide range of tasks from starting up the equipment, adjusting filtrate flow rates and suction pressure, measuring filter cake dryness and moisture content, replacing and cleaning filter cloths, to daily inspections and simple maintenance. To ensure stable operation of the production line and maintain quality, they are required to manage work records and equipment data, investigate causes and provide initial response in case of abnormalities.
